Abstract
The utility model relates to the technical field of steel member processing, and discloses a steel member welding butt joint adjustment positioning device, wherein an output shaft of a motor is fixedly connected with a first gear, the side face of the first gear is connected with a second gear in a meshed manner, four groups of fixing frames are annularly distributed on the inner surface of the second gear, each fixing frame is internally connected with an electric telescopic rod, the telescopic ends of the electric telescopic rods are fixedly connected with clamping plates, the side face of the second gear is fixedly connected with a limiting sleeve, the positioning mechanism is simple in structure and small in size, workers can conveniently move the steel members, after one side of a steel structure is welded, the positions of the steel members can be adjusted, welding of the steel members can be conveniently completed, the annular distributed clamping plates can ensure that the device can fix the steel members with different shapes, the practicability of the device is improved, and the moving stability of the steel members is ensured through the limiting sleeve.

Background
In the construction of steel members, because the length of the material often does not reach the length of actual needs, manual welding is generally required to lengthen the length of the steel members can reach the use standard, and when the steel members are welded, an adjusting and positioning device is required to be used for fixing the steel members, so that the welding surfaces of the materials are mutually attached.
The existing butt joint adjusting and positioning device is large in size, in the construction process of steel members, the butt joint adjusting and positioning device with large size is often in a high building and inconvenient to move, the butt joint adjusting and positioning device is difficult to use, more parts are needed to be adopted, the use cost and the production cost are increased, in the prior art represented by a butt joint welding and positioning device (publication No. CN 211708530U) with a steel structure, two adjusting mechanisms which are close to the inner side are moved to one end of a pipe to be welded through a rotating shaft rotating wheel, a connecting plate is inserted into a connecting plate clamping groove, the rotating pressing shaft rotating wheel is used for adjusting positions of the two pipes to be welded again through scale marks arranged on a pressing shaft, the two pipes are enabled to achieve required straightness, finally the pressing shaft rotating wheel is screwed tightly, the pressing plate is enabled to be tightly attached to the pipe, the end of the pipe to be welded is enabled to be attached to the connecting plate, and finally the two pipes are welded into an integrated scheme through manpower.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
Referring to fig. 1 to 4, the utility model provides a steel member welding butt joint adjustment positioning device, which comprises a welding cylinder 1, wherein both sides of the outer surface of the welding cylinder 1 are connected with a positioning mechanism 2, the positioning mechanism 2 comprises a motor 21, an output shaft of the motor 21 is fixedly connected with a first gear 22, the side surface of the first gear 22 is in meshed connection with a second gear 23, four groups of fixing frames 24 are annularly distributed on the inner surface of the second gear 23, the inner surface of each fixing frame 24 is connected with an electric telescopic rod 241, the telescopic end of the electric telescopic rod 241 is fixedly connected with a clamping plate 242, and the side surface of the second gear 23 is fixedly connected with a limiting sleeve 25.
The motor 21 passes through the surface fixed connection of bolt and welding cylinder 1, and welding cylinder 1's lower surface fixed connection has support frame 11, and the workman rises to required place with welding cylinder 1, has guaranteed the portability of the device, and support frame 11 provides stable support for welding cylinder 1.
The outer surface fixedly connected with spacing collar of stop collar 25, welding cylinder 1 locates the surface of stop collar 25 through spacing collar movable sleeve, through the stop collar 25 of setting, has guaranteed the rotatory stability of second gear 23.
The welding cylinder 1 and the second gear 23 are of penetrating structures, a welding port 12 is formed in the upper surface of the welding cylinder 1, and a worker welds the steel member through the welding port 12.
The electric telescopic rod 241 is fixedly connected with the inner wall of the second gear 23 through a bolt, the telescopic end of the electric telescopic rod 241 movably penetrates through the upper surface of the fixing frame 24, the electric telescopic rod 241 drives the clamping plate 242 to move, and accordingly steel members are fixed, and the annular distributed clamping plate 242 ensures that the device can fix steel members with different shapes.
The two positioning mechanisms 2 are distributed on two sides of the welding cylinder 1 in a mirror image mode, the axes of the two second gears 23 are located on the same horizontal line, and the second gears 23 drive the steel structure to rotate through the clamping plates 242, so that the steel member is convenient to rotate, and welding is convenient to conduct on the steel member.
Working principle: when the device is used, a worker lifts the welding cylinder 1 to a required place, inserts two steel members into the second gear 23 respectively, makes two ends of the two steel members preliminarily aligned, then starts the electric telescopic rod 241, drives the clamping plates 242 to move, so that the steel members are fixed, the annularly distributed clamping plates 242 ensure that the device can fix the steel members with different shapes, after the fixing is finished, welding surfaces of the steel members are mutually abutted, workers weld the steel members through the welding ports 12, after one surface of the steel structure is welded, the motor 21 is started, the motor 21 drives the second gear 23 to rotate through the first gear 22, the second gear 23 drives the steel structure to rotate through the clamping plates 242, the steel members are conveniently rotated, the steel members are conveniently welded, and the rotating stability of the second gear 23 is ensured through the limiting sleeve 25.
